A demonstration of how to modify a fiberglass aircraft engine cowl to provide a better fit is shown. Polyurethane foam is used to create a new shape and then fiberglass cloth is used to make the structure. A resin is then applied to the fiberglass cloth. The purpose of the video is to demonstrate one technique for repairing/modifying an existing fiberglass component.
